Actin Myofilaments
Protein filaments that, along with myosin, play a key role in the contraction of muscle cells by forming the thin filaments in the structure of muscle fibers.
Smooth Muscle
A type of muscle found in the walls of internal organs like the stomach and intestines, responsible for involuntary movements.
Resting Length
The length of a muscle when it is not actively contracted or stretched, influencing its ability to generate force.
Sarcomeres
The fundamental units of muscle contraction, composed of long, fibrous proteins that slide past each other when muscles contract and relax.
